DribbleUp is more than just a soccer ball — it’s a complete digital training ecosystem. It pairs a regulation-size smart soccer ball with a smartphone app that uses computer vision to analyze movements, grade performance, and guide users through structured drills and challenges.

  •  Interactive Training Sessions

The app offers a growing library of over 1,000 on-demand training classes, covering skills like:

  • Dribbling control
  • Speed footwork drills
  • Change of direction
  • Juggling and combo moves
  • Ball mastery for both feet

Each session is led by real coaches who demonstrate and break down each drill. The app’s AI adjusts difficulty over time, ensuring continuous growth.

  •  Real-Time Performance Tracking

Using your phone’s front-facing camera, DribbleUp’s app tracks the ball’s movement and provides real-time feedback. It scores your accuracy, speed, and consistency — key metrics that help players identify strengths and areas for improvement.

  •  Progress Tracking and Leaderboards

Users can view their historical performance, earn medals, and compare their stats to other players. The competitive element boosts motivation, especially for young players who thrive on challenges and leaderboards.

Cons to Consider

  •  Device Sensitivity: Some users report tracking inconsistencies depending on lighting, phone model, or room layout.
  •  Subscription Required: While the ball comes with some free content, full access to the training library requires a monthly subscription.
  •  Initial Learning Curve: Younger children may need assistance setting up the camera and app interface initially.
